
Set a stack at the back of the endzone, with one cutter (C1) as the ISO (a person isolated in the endzone). The person with the disc (in this case, H1) should call out someone's name to indicate that they are being isolated.C1 should set up on the BREAKSIDE, and attempt to get open. If they are not open within 3 stalls, H1 can swing the disc to H2 or H3.C4 (the person last in the stack) can come under on either side if they see the opportunity to do so, but DO NOT get in the way of the person being isolated.
